3. Design Features of Bentley Brake Discs


Bentley brake discs are engineered with precision, reflecting the brand's commitment to quality. Key design features include:

3.1 Ventilation


Most Bentley brake discs utilize **ventilated designs** to enhance cooling. This is crucial for maintaining performance during prolonged braking situations, preventing overheating, and reducing brake fade.

3.2 Groove Patterns


The groove patterns on Bentley discs serve multiple purposes, including improving friction, enhancing water dispersion, and reducing noise. These design elements are crucial for delivering a smooth and consistent braking experience.

3.3 Weight Considerations


The weight of brake discs can significantly impact vehicle dynamics. Bentley employs lightweight materials while ensuring durability, contributing to better acceleration and handling.

4. Materials Used in Bentley Brake Discs


The materials used in brake discs are central to their performance and durability. Bentley typically utilizes the following materials:

4.1 Cast Iron


Cast iron is the most common material for brake discs due to its excellent heat dissipation properties and affordability. Many Bentley models feature high-carbon cast iron discs, which improve performance and longevity.

4.2 Carbon-Carbon Composites


For high-performance models, Bentley may use carbon-carbon composite brake discs. These are known for their exceptional heat resistance and lightweight characteristics, making them ideal for sporty driving conditions.

7. Maintenance Tips for Bentley Brake Discs


Proper maintenance is essential for prolonging the life of your brake discs. Here are some tips:

7.1 Regular Inspections


Regularly inspect your brake discs for signs of wear or damage. Look for grooves, cracks, or uneven surfaces, which could indicate the need for replacement.

7.2 Cleaning


Keep the brake discs clean from debris and dust to maintain optimal performance. Using a specialized brake cleaner can help remove contaminants.

7.3 Pad Replacement


Monitor brake pad thickness and replace them as needed. Worn pads can lead to increased wear on the discs, affecting overall performance.

8. Troubleshooting Common Brake Disc Issues


Despite best efforts, issues may arise with brake discs. Here’s how to troubleshoot common problems:

8.1 Squeaking or Grinding Noises


If you hear squeaking or grinding noises, it could indicate worn brake pads or debris caught between the rotor and pad. Inspect and address this immediately.

8.2 Vibration During Braking


Vibration can signal warped discs. This often requires professional assessment and possibly replacement of the discs.

8.3 Reduced Stopping Power


If you notice a decrease in stopping power, check for issues such as worn pads, contaminated discs, or air in the brake lines.

10. Frequently Asked Questions


10.1 What are the signs of worn brake discs?


Signs include squeaking or grinding noises, vibrations during braking, and reduced stopping power.

10.2 How often should I replace my Bentley brake discs?


It depends on driving conditions, but a general guideline is to inspect them every 20,000 miles and replace them if necessary.

10.3 Can I use aftermarket brake discs on my Bentley?


Yes, but ensure they meet Bentley’s specifications for optimal performance and safety.

10.4 How do I clean my brake discs?


Use a specialized brake cleaner and a soft cloth to remove dust and debris without damaging the surface.

10.5 What is the difference between cast iron and carbon-carbon brake discs?


Cast iron is more common and affordable, while carbon-carbon composites offer superior heat resistance and are typically used in high-performance models.
